I'm currently working on an open source Simulink toolbox [1]. By exploiting a TLC file it has has the support of inlining the developed Level-2 C S-Functions in order to support Simulink Coder code generation.
I noticed that the automatically generated sources are not completely standalone. They actually depend to headers located into the Matlab system folders (extern/ simulink/ rtw/) containing mainly defines and typedefs.
One of our aim is to deploy the generated code to the target platform, and be able to compile them from a machine without Matlab. Only these few headers are missing, there's no need to link any of Matlab's library.
Would it be possible to redistribute the headers stored in such folders? Considering this is an open source project, also these headers would be publicly available.
